A Crushed Rose is a true story. A beautiful child was robbed of her youth. Her voice was muted, spirit crushed, and body violated. Her eyes showed fear, sadness, and depression; people labeled her shy. She whispered her story to a few adults; they smiled and pretended not to understand. Incest is a sexual union between persons who are so closely related that their marriage is illegal or forbidden by custom. An informed community and enlightened culture is obligated to expose crimes against children. As an adult, she engaged in a six-year war to save her daughter from being put to death by the state of Mississippi. That fight gave her strength to battle for her health and peace of mind. She ended her fight with God and turned on the real enemy. She prevailed with a clear message to openly fight all forms of sexual violence against children, including the most horrendous depravity-incest.

About The Author

Roszalia Ellen is a child prodigy. At the age of two she exhibited an extraordinary gift for music. Roszalia would run her fingers across the piano and she could play any tune that she heard. As a train thundered down the tracks and the engineer pulled the whistle, she would call it out: "That is a low baritone in the key of F." She became a church musician at the age of nine, and to this day in 2011 she plays piano for a local church. She attended Jackson State University in Mississippi. Once, during an audition, while facing the wall, she named all eighty-eight keys on the piano, as her instructor played them. She is also a singer, and has been compared favorably to the Queen of Soul, Ms. Aretha Franklin. Before, during, and after the reign of terror, Roszalia Ellen loved music.
